Meet At-Large Candidates For City Council On March 20
The Penn Quarter Neighborhood Association’s (PQNA) March meeting will take place the morning of March 20 at the First Congregational Church (NE corner of 10th and G St NW). All At-Large candidates for the April 23 special election plan to be present to offer their views so you can make an informed choice at the polls. The candidates’ websites are linked below.

DC Council At-Large Candidates 9:05am (All At-Large Candidates Attending)Anita Bonds
Chair, DC Democratic State Committee and Interim At Large Council member
Former Ward 5E ANC Chairperson
Worked for Mayors Marion Barry, Sharon Pratt Kelly & Anthony Williams
Democrat, Lives in Ward 5 in Truxton Circle/Shaw
www.anitabonds.comMichael A. Brown
Partner at The Madison Group
Former At-Large Council member
Former Democratic National Committee National Finance Vice Chairman
Democrat, Lives in Ward 4 in Chevy Chase
www.michaelbrown2013.comMatthew Frumin
ANC 3E Commissioner & former Chairman
Attorney (on leave) with Cassidy Levy Kent
Worked for the National Democratic Institute and the International Human Rights Law Group
Democrat, Lives in Ward 3 in AU Park
www.matthewfrumin.comPatrick Mara
Principal/Owner, The Dolan Group
Ward 1 Member Board of Education
Republican, Lives in Ward 1 in Columbia Heights
www.patrickmara.comPerry Redd
Songwriter & host of internet radio show, Socially Speaking
Co-managed the 2010 At Large Statehood-Green candidate’s campaign
Statehood-Green, Lives in Ward 4, in Brightwood Park/Manor Park
www.redd4council.comElissa Silverman
Analyst (on leave) for the DC Fiscal Policy Institute
Former reporter for The Washington Post and Washington City Paper
Democrat, Lives in Ward 6 near H Street, NE
www.elissa2013.comPaul Zukerberg
Attorney at Zukerberg Law Center, PLLC
Democrat, Lives in Ward 1 in Adams-Morgan/Lanier Heights
